J. M. MCCALL is a scholar working on Organic Chemistry, Molecular Biology and Physical and Theoretical Chemistry. According to data from OpenAlex, J. M. MCCALL has authored 16 papers receiving a total of 780 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Organic Chemistry, 3 papers in Molecular Biology and 2 papers in Physical and Theoretical Chemistry. Recurrent topics in J. M. MCCALL's work include Synthesis and Reactivity of Heterocycles (2 papers), Free Radicals and Antioxidants (2 papers) and Chemical Reaction Mechanisms (2 papers). J. M. MCCALL is often cited by papers focused on Synthesis and Reactivity of Heterocycles (2 papers), Free Radicals and Antioxidants (2 papers) and Chemical Reaction Mechanisms (2 papers). J. M. MCCALL collaborates with scholars based in United States and United Kingdom. J. M. MCCALL's co-authors include J. Mark Braughler, E. Jon Jacobsen, R L Chase, L A Duncan, Edward D. Hall, Eugene D. Means, Patricia A. Yonkers, Ruth E. TenBrink, A. SHAVER and Donald E. Leyden and has published in prestigious journals such as Journal of Biological Chemistry, The Journal of Physical Chemistry and Journal of Medicinal Chemistry.
